## Configuration — LinkVane Deep-Link Router

LinkVane resolves inbound deep links to screen routes on both mobile clients. Copy `env.sample` to `.env` before running the resolver locally. Set `LINKVANE_SCHEME` and `LINKVANE_FALLBACK_URL` first. The route-map service also requires a signing secret to verify link payloads. Append the following line to your `.env` to set it:

sealed setting: LEDGER_TOKEN5=bcca1

### Step 4: Slim the image

Strip build tooling before publishing your Fernwick plugin image. Use the two-stage build in the template repo; copy only the dist folder and runtime deps. Target under 120 MB compressed. Drop docs, tests, and locale packs. Run the slimmer with `fernctl image slim` and confirm the report shows no dev layers. The slimmed image still needs the registry push credential at runtime, so set it in the env file with this line:

env line for yahip-tafog: RELAY_SECRET3=4ca

## Formula sandbox tuning

User-supplied formulas in Gridmoor execute inside a restricted interpreter with hard ceilings on time, memory, and call depth. Reviewers should confirm any change to these ceilings is justified in the PR description, since raising them widens the abuse surface. Defaults were chosen from production traces. The current limits are as follows.

limits module of tafog-fawip:
WEIGHTS = {
    "julix": 57,
    "lamys": 992,
    "kasvan": 209,
    "quenok": 750,
    "alddor": 259,
    "oliath": 1009,
    "wenix": 815,
}

## Release Step: Feed Validator Check

Before promoting a Castwright release, run the podcast feed validator against the staging catalog. The validator, Feedwarden, checks every show's RSS output for malformed enclosures, missing episode GUIDs, and artwork size violations. A release must not ship with any error-level findings; warnings may be waived with a note in the release log. Feedwarden runs as a one-off job from the deploy host and authenticates to the internal catalog service using the key below.

gateway credential: kto2_aa